Monopolistically Competitive
A market structure where many companies sell products that are similar but not identical, allowing for slight differentiation and some pricing power.
Fixed Costs
Costs that do not change with the level of output or activity, such as rent or salaries.
Short Run
A period during which at least one of a firm's inputs is fixed, limiting the firm's ability to adjust production in response to market changes.
